union dues are deducted from a paycheck at a rate of 4.5% of the total earnings each week if a part time employee works 20 hours

per week and earns $6 per hour, what would be the dues deduction?

First, you want to find how much the employee is making per week

In this cause, you would multiply 20 × 6

20 × 6 = 120

The employee makes $120 per week.

Then you will need to find what is 4.5% of $120.

Before you multiply, you want to move the decimal place 2 times to the left. You would end up with .045

You would multiply those two numbers

0.45 × 120 = 5.4

$5.4 is the amount of money being deducted to your sub total

$5.4 would be the dues deducted

Mary who is 13 years old wants to have $8500 to travel to Argentina when she’s 21 years old. She currently has $6439 in savings

Answer:

a; she will have $8812

b: It will be enough for her trip

Step-by-step explanation:

In this question, we are tasked with calculating how much a certain value in a savings account that is earning an interest that is compounded annually will be worth.

To calculate this, we use the compound interest formula;

A = P((1+r/n)^{nt}

Where A is the amount after that number of years which of course we want to calculate

P is the principal amount which is the amount we are investing which is $6439 according to the question

r is the interest rate which is 4% = 4/100 = 0.04

t is the time which is 8 years

n is 1 which is the number of times interest will be compounded annually

We plug these values as follows;

A = 6439(1 + 0.04/1)^8

A = 6439(1.04)^8

A = $8,812.22

This amount is greater then the needed $8,500 for the trip and of course it will be enough
